A lot of people make money through tax evasion but far fewer manage to make money through tax compliance. Nonetheless, an artificial intelligence start-up led by a former Macquarie banker in San Francisco is aiming to do that, and is already valued at $150 million after barely a year of operation.
Founded by Australian Nicholas Rudder, Sphere launched in December last year as a tax engine that uses large language models to analyse tax law all over the world to help start-ups navigate their obligations.
